Rid pantsbuild.pants of an un-needed antlr dep.
Review Request #1989 - Created March 25, 2015 and submitted
|dturner-tw, lahosken, patricklaw, zundel|
The dep is only needed by 1 test that attempts to use the generated code to parse via the antlr runtime. This change lifts the dep from the requirements.txt file used to bootstrap pants into a stand-alone python_requirement_library that the test can depend on without forcing each pants bootstrap to fetch this dep. Since 3rdparty/python/BUILD was used for an include in the docs, doc gen broke leading to fixes for CI doc gen errors. 3rdparty/python/BUILD | 9 ++++++++- 3rdparty/python/requirements.txt | 5 ----- build-support/bin/release.sh | 6 +----- examples/src/python/example/3rdparty_py.md | 2 +- src/python/pants/CHANGELOG.rst | 6 +++--- src/python/pants/backend/python/BUILD | 1 - testprojects/src/python/antlr/BUILD | 1 - 7 files changed, 13 insertions(+), 17 deletions(-)
CI went green here: